QUARTERLY PLANNING NOTE — Sales Leads

Short version: we're renegotiating the lease on the Fernbrook Plaza showroom. Talks with the landlord, Castellan Properties, kick off next month, and the outcome affects our regional demo budget. Don't commit to any in-showroom events past September until this settles. Marguerite will share timelines soon. The detail below is strictly confidential.

management briefing: The finance team signed off on a budget of $43.1 million for Project Fenwyn. The renewal with Wenirax Foods closes at $39.9 million a year, 51 percent above the last contract.

Subject: Partner SFTP drop — new owner

Hi,

As you review the pending changes to the Harborline ingest scripts, note that ownership of the partner SFTP drop is changing at the end of the month. This includes key rotation, the nightly pull job, and the quarantine folder for malformed files. Review comments on the retry logic should still go through the normal PR flow, but questions about drop-folder conventions or partner onboarding now go to the new owner. The incoming owner is listed below.

signatory, tagaf-bahaf: Praael Fenmir Rusok

## Changelog — Font vendoring defaults changed

As of this release, the Bracken UI build no longer fetches third-party fonts at build time. All typefaces used by the Lanternwell suite are now vendored into the repo under a dedicated assets directory, and the fetch step is skipped by default. If you're onboarding, nothing to install — the fonts travel with the checkout. The build flags controlling this behavior are listed below.

settings of hadup-yafog:
LAMAEL_PIN=3761
LAMAEL_TENANT=istmir
LAMAEL_METRICS_HOST=metrics.lamael.plorvasys.test
LAMAEL_SEAL=seal_8ea68500
LAMAEL_STANDBY_TEAM=fraok

Release runbook — ChronoGate Reader v4.2 (Fenwick Timing Systems)

Before pushing firmware to trackside ChronoGate readers, confirm the staging mat at the Arlowe Harbor course reports chip reads within 20ms tolerance. Support should hold all customer firmware tickets during the rollout window. If a reader drops into fallback mode, power-cycle once before escalating to the Pellam duty engineer. All firmware bundles must be signed before the updater will accept them. Use the signing key below when packaging the release:

release key, fahaf-bajof: bky3_Xam